The Village at Rockville is looking for an LPN who brings strong clinical experience and a passion for leading people. As an LPN Nurse Manager, your role blends clinical leadership with people leadership. You’ll help ensure exceptional resident care while coaching, developing, and supporting the nursing team responsible for delivering it. Whether you’re an experienced nurse leader or an LPN ready to grow into a larger leadership role, you’ll work alongside the ADON, other Nurse Managers, Staffing Coordinator, and interdisciplinary team to make a meaningful impact on residents and the team you lead. The Village at Rockville is a faith-based, not-for-profit life plan community and part of National Lutheran Communities & Services. Here, leadership is about creating an environment where residents thrive and team members have the support and direction they need to succeed. What you’ll do Ensure the highest degree of quality resident care is delivered and maintained at all times. Provide strong supervision, performance management, leadership, and coaching for nursing staff. Train and onboard nursing team members, ensuring they understand and uphold NLCS standards of service excellence and nursing practice. Collaborate with the interdisciplinary team to identify opportunities to improve resident care and implement appropriate changes. Monitor staffing, unit activities, and acuity; work with the Staffing Coordinator, ADON, and Nurse Managers to ensure safe and appropriate coverage. Conduct regular rounds on assigned units to monitor resident activity, care quality, and overall environment, including rotating weekends and holidays. Verify care activity and documentation to ensure nursing care is provided according to physician orders, care plans, standards, and facility policies. Ensure safe, accurate medication administration consistent with nursing standards and NLCS procedures. Review and support accurate completion of resident assessments, MDS, and individualized plans of care; participate in and/or direct care plan conferences. Review and maintain infection control, wound, lab, and related logs to support continuity of care and regulatory compliance. Hold regular coaching conversations and conduct stay interviews with team members to build engagement, retention, and accountability. Help oversee department-related reporting, including licensure, education, and attendance compliance, in coordination with HR/payroll and leadership. Perform other leadership and clinical duties as assigned to support residents, staff, and overall unit operations. What you bring Licensed Practical Nurse (LPN) currently licensed and in good standing in the state of employment CPR and First Aid certifications required. Knowledge of Geriatric Nursing Assistant and Licensed Practical Nurse scope of practice. Experience in geriatric and/or subacute nursing, including medication and treatment administration, and unit and/or house supervision. Demonstrated leadership exper…
